Text

(a)(Effective until July 1, 2025) Department Head. - The head of each principal State department, except those departments headed by popularly elected officers, shall be appointed by the Governor and serve at the Governor's pleasure. The salary of the head of each of the principal State departments shall be set by the Governor, and the salary of elected officials shall be as provided by law.
(a)(Effective July 1, 2025) Department Head. - Except as otherwise provided in this Chapter, the head of each principal State department, except those departments headed by popularly elected officers, shall be appointed by the Governor and serve at the Governor's pleasure.
